The Round 1 log of my #100DaysOfCode challenge. Started on [June 01, Friday, 2018].
Today's Progress: Fixed the image responsive issue in my product landing page. Solved challenges in hackerRank focus on loops, inheritance, template literals and arrow functions. Code some js again in FCC.
Link to work: Product Landing Page | CraftApp
Today's Progress: Finish the css and logo design of my product landing page, preview live will be update later. Done with 4th day js and code challenge and some JS comparison, logical operator and if...else statements.
Link to work: Product Landing Page | CraftApp
Today's Progress: Finished the 3rd day of js and code problem challenge. Doing pretty good in FCC js section. Structured the body my product landing page.
Link to work: Product Landing Page | CraftApp
Today's Progress: Continue to solve problem challenges in #10daysOfJS and #30daysOfCode in hackerRank focusing on Operators. Continue the js road in FCC, centering in function with return.
Today's Progress: Started codeKata in hackerRank, #10daysOfjs, #30daysOfCode problem challenges to improve my problem solving skills. Continue the js in FCC.
Today's Progress: Planning for the product landing page. Finish the jQuery and assessment, that makes the introduction to js in learn-co complete. Dive into functions in js-basics and continue the vanilla js in FCC.
Today's Progress: Did some manipulation in the DOM using jQuery in learn-co and play with vanilla js in FCC. Finish the arrays in js-basics. Completed survey form project for developers and it's currently live on my repository.
Link to work: Survey Form for Developers
Today's Progress: Completed a tribute page for The Bible and it's currently live. Done some js in FCC, arrays exercise in js-basics and jquery in learn-co.
Link to work: Tribute Page | The Bible
Today's Progress: Started with the jQuery in learn-co, and started with the array exercises in js-basics. Continue to play js in FCC. Started a tribute page, planning to finish it tomorrow.
Today's Progress: Finish the DOM section in learn-co, and Objects in js-basics, then continue to play with js in FCC.
Today's Progress: Continue playing with the DOM in learn-co and in Objects section in js basics course. Started the js certification in FCC.
Today's Progress: Started the DOM in learn-co and Completed the control flow in js basics course.
Today's Progress: Completed loops in learn-co and operators in js basics for beginners udemy course then started control flow.
Today's Progress: Practice css grid in FCC and review some javaScript concepts in MDN.
Today's Progress: Read some tutorials in blogs and started css-grid in FCC.
Today's Progress: Completed the data structures in learn-co and flexbox in FCC.
Today's Progress: Continue to work on a flexbox in FCC and review the data structures in learn-co.
Today's Progress: Started and Finish the RWD Principles in FCC and then proceed to Flexbox.
Today's Progress: Finish the pre-programming course and Applied accessibility challenge in FCC.
Today's Progress: Done some Applied Accesibility in FCC. Learn more about the tech trends in pre-programming.
Today's Progress: Finish Applied VIsual Design and started Applied Accessibility in FCC. Done some objects and arrays data structure in learn-co.
Today's Progress: Not feeling well, but still I code in learn-co and done some Applied Visual Design in FCC.
Today's Progress: Went over in the CMS and advanced concepts in pre-programming and then Run through the data structures in learn.co. Lastly done some CSS in FCC.
Today's Progress: Diving in the Applied Visual Design (3rd section) of RWD in FCC. Learned a lot in learn.co functions and scope section. Understanding more about frameworks and APIs in pre-programming.
Today's Progress: 2nd section of RWD in FCC and Core Concept section in pre-programming are done.
Today's Progress: Started the 2nd section of RWD in FCC. Done with the front, back and stacks section of pre-programing course.
Today's Progress: Started fCC again from scratch and finish the 1st section of RWD and went thought the learn.co functions and scope lab.
Today's Progress: Tackle all about the web and some mobile in internet section in pre-programming course.
Today's Progress: Finish the basic concepts behind computer as a developer in pre-programming course.
Today's Progress: Review writing functions, working with strings, difference between return and logging.
Today's Progress: Review the Flow Control using if else, switch, and ternary operatorn, and apply it in the exercises.
Today's Progress: Review Manipulating strings and practice interpolating with template literals.
Today's Progress: Review all about variables, concept, declaring and defining and multi-line variable assignment.
Today's Progress: Finished the basics, continued the foundation with introduction to functions.
Today's Progress: Started Introduction to javaScript on a online bootcamp. Set up my coding environment and integrated my github to the platform. Tackled the basic of the language.
Today's Progress: I lost track of my progress because of unmotivated and procrastination, but as a developer sometimes that's normal and needs to overcome it. I didn't stop learning while fixing my laptop, I still read some articles about best practices as a developer.
Another start of the month and I'll continue my progress without fail.
Today's Progress: Teaching Yourself chapter is done.
Losing motivation as a self-taught developer is normal, but you need to find the things that motivates you or remember the enthusiasm you had before when you started learning that specific subject.
Today's Progress: Learned more about the three different strategies or paths for a genuine software development.
Today's Progress: Changing the way how I approach in learning Plang, frameworks, and libraries. "The Complete Software Developer's Career Guide" Chapter 5 && 6 done.
Today's Progress: Finished chapter 4, organizing all my vision and goals, applying the quadrants matrix to determine the importance and urgency of each goals.
Today's Progress: Continue with the same book, reviewed the tech skills that must have, PLang, structuring code, OO design, algorithms and data structures.
Today's Progress: Started reading another book "The Complete Software Developer's Career Guide", currently in chapter 3.
Today's Progress: Started and finished a short course "How to Use SMART Goals" to achieve more in less time and to gain clarity as my goal setting system.
Today's Progress: Continue with the cs101 problem set. Literally struggling with the sets. This time I can't connect the dots, struggle to use the concepts I learned the combined it to a solution
Today's Progress: Continue with cs101 lectures and exercises. Having a hard time answering quizzes and problem sets.
Today's Progress: Continue the cs101, practice problem solving concepts, practice solving the problem using algorithm pseudocode before putting it into code.
Today's Progress: Wasn't able to code, fix some drivers on my laptop.
Today's Progress: Review the procedure, controls and constructs of Computer Science. Finished the unit 2 of cs101.
Today's Progress: finished the advanced css and sass course. Started unit 2 of cs101.
Today's Progress: Learning the concepts of CSS grid and put it into practice by applying it in a project.
Today's Progress: Started cs101 again, to review cs concepts, with quizzes,exercises and problem sets.
Today's Progress: Continue to read ch 17-20 of "asmartwaytolearnjavascript" and it's interactive exercise. Practiced CSS grid in codepen.
Today's Progress: Learning CSS grid for multi-dimensional system, to replace floats, use less and readable code, and much more logical CSS code.
Today's Progress: Update natours popup project and used flexbox on it.
Today's Progress: I started learning flexbox more in depth and I learned a lot of tricks in positioning items, and most of it can be done in flexbox.
Today's Progress: Created a build process for the sass project, compiled sass into css, merge the css files into one css, add prefixes auto, and compressed the whole code.
Today's Progress: Not much coding today, just continued the project with sass, and read two chapters of "asmartwaytolearnjavascript" and interactive practice.
Today's Progress: Done making the project responsive for big and smaller device since I used the desktop-first approach. Review the arrays keywords and methods through "asmartwaytolearnjavascript" with the interactive exercise.
Today's Progress: Read the "asmartwaytolearnjavascript" with the interactive exercise. And focused more in finishing the natours project.
Today's Progress: Read the Chapter 11 to 13 of "asmartwaytolearnjavascript" with the interactice exercise. Continue a project with SASS.
Today's Progress: Done reading chapter 9 && 10 of "asmartwaytolearnjavascript" with the interactive exercise. Review again with some FCC's HTML, CSS and javaScript. And continue the "advanced CSS and SASS" course.
Today's Progress: Done reading chapter 7 && 8 of "asmartwaytolearnjavascript" with the interactive exercise. Review some FCC's HTML, CSS and javaScript.
Today's Progress: Not much coding today, but continue to read "A Smarter Way to Learn javaScript" and did exercise 6.
Today's Progress: Continue learning through the advanced css and sass udemy course, and read some chapters of "A Smarter Way to Learn javaScript" and did some interactive practices.
Today's Progress: Practing SASS on my current project to organize and make the code maintainable. And I deep dived with the backtracking, branching and using Git for Collaboration. Started Reading "A Smarter Way to Learn".
Today's Progress: Applied logical Architecture and BEM and SAAS to my current project. Started using relative units instead of absolute units. Studied box-model, types, positioning, stack, and how CSS is being parsed.
Today's Progress: Submit and upload the tribute page for the mean time. I will rewrite it again later on, after I grasp a good css design. Practicing css design, having a hard time organizing my css codes.
Today's Progress: I learned a lot of CSS properties and applied it on the Finished Omnifood project. Applied almost all the basic to advanced properties to the project, but the problem now is how to retain all those knowledge I learned.
Today's Progress: Using positioning border, container, fonts in my tribute project.
Today's Progress: Practiced some CSS design in my tribute project in FCC.
Designing is really hard, it can only be achieved through trial and error, by trying and applying it, so it's better than never.
Today's Progress: Started doing es6 in FCC. Read some course from simple programmer.
Today's Progress: Finished the basicJS in FCC by doing it in a slow pace.
Today's Progress: I was not able to code because I'm fixing my setup with my vscode, integrated terminal, and nvm, having trouble with my WSL setup. any suggestion?
Today's Progress: Not very productive day.. Done some js in FCC very slowly, almost consume all day in reading dev articles, and some design inspiration, instead of doing my works and projects I procrastinated again.. What to do?
Today's Progress: Not much coding today, just read YDKJS, finished some JS in FCC. Starting tomorrow I'll try apply some CSS I learned from other developers to my FCC tribute project.
Today's Progress: Completed tribute html structure, planning and making a layout design. Next is CSS.
Today's Progress: I started a small project which is a tribute page to Jesus Christ and The Bible. Just HTML for now for the body structure. Looking others design for design inspiration purposes, it's really hard when you are not creative.
Today's Progress: Continued the psets in cs50 and working out algorithms and data structure. Done some js in FCC. having a hard time with the pset4 and pset5 of cs50. Maybe I'll to fix it again tomorrow, then some of my friends recommended to read Head First HTML5 Programming maybe I'll give it a try.
Today's Progress: Review the psets in cs50 and refactor the code, still using Clang. Continue the js in FCC but slowing the pace to absorb most of it. Sometimes when we have the time to study, we have this adrenaline to finish all the courses, books and tutorials in short span of time, while I'm reading some articles and motivational experience I read that it's best to slow down the pace when learning so our brain will have the time to process all the learnings. Planning to start using the spaced repition software soon after I set it up, so I can retain most of the books and courses I've finish.
Today's Progress: Read an article How to get hired, Memorizing a programming language using spaced repetition software, and Should you learn programming? Yes.. Solving pset in cs50 using Clang.
Today's Progress: Working with the pset of cs50 and basicJS in FCC. Continue reading YDKJS. Investing more with the concepts of programming and computer science is beneficial in the long run.
Today's Progress: Continue the basicJS challenge in FCC and read the YDKJS Up and Going. Understanding the JS more.
Today's Progress: Not much coding today, just read some related projects while doing some js challenge in FCC. Thinking and planning for my projects and display it in github for a future reference, while learning more in depth.
Today's Progress: Study ssh more and integrating it to my git and github, as well as using the WSL bash into my vscode. Started javascript in FCC. Setting up ssh on my dev is very challenging, because I have WSL on my environment, I always get this error `Permission denied (publickey).
Today's Progress: Read the Best Programming Practices of Udacity includes developing well-structured programs, naming convention, indentation and using comments for the readability of the code.
Today's Progress: Had a hard time understanding and setting up a ssh, but tommorow will deep dive into it because of permission problem with github. Finished the CSS Grid in FCC. Submitted the pset3 music in cs50.
Today's Progress: Not very productive today, just went to some CSS Grid in FCC and then practice algorithm with cs50.
Today's Progress: Deep dive into algorithm with cs50 lesson 4, and finished CSS Flexbox in FCC, I realize there's a lot of things I need to learn even in CSS, planning to deep dive into advanced CSS within 100days.
Today's Progress: Refreshed my algorthm skills with part3 of cs50, then finished the Responsive Web Design Principles track in FCC.
Today's Progress: Not much coding today, just went in FCC challenges and finished the Applied Accessibility track.
Today's Progress: Finished the lecture 2 and pset2 in CS50. Deep dive even more with the concepts of programming using C. C language is really hard, but I think getting the basic concepts of programming in this language is giving you a better understanding of the general concepts.
Today's Progress: Finished the lecture 1 and pset 1 in CS50. Interacted with the CS50 IDE using C language. Brushing up my understanding in foundational concepts of programming.
Today's Progress: Finished the Lecture 0 edX CS50. Practice programming using pseudo code and explored Scratch programming.
Today's Progress: Finished the learn to Code html & CSS lesson 3, and the Applied Visual Design part in FCC.
Today's Progress: Finished the lesson 2 of learn to Code html & CSS and Basic CSS in FCC. Read a blog A bright future for GitHub
Today's Progress: Finished the Basic HTML and HTML5 and half part of CSS in FCC, continued reading YDKJS Up and Going and done some of Learn to Code HTML & CSS
Today's Progress: Restarted the progress on FreeCodeCamp, and reading YDKJS Up and Going. I've spent only 30mins in coding because of other activities, but it's still better than never.
Today's Progress: Setup my Development Environment, and made a repo for my progress here.